Preferred Label : Mycobacterium mucogenicum;
NCIt related terms : MYCOLICIBACTERIUM MUCOGENICUM;
NCIt definition : A species of nonpigmented, nonmotile, and weakly Gram-positive bacteria in the family
Mycobacteriaceae. M. mucogenicum has been identified as a water contaminant in hospitals
and infection is associated with clinical diseases in both immunocompromised and immunocompetent
individuals. The species is tolerant to disinfection by chlorination and extreme temperatures,
and to traditional antimycobacterial agents, but is susceptible to amikacin, imipenem,
cefoxitin, clarithromycin, ciprofloxacin, the new fluoroquinolones, and trimethoprim/sulfamethoxazole.;
